Is Lake View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Lake View in Derby, KS has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 30, which is 70%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Derby average (crime index 49), Lake View is 19% lower in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 115, 15%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 18).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.

What are the demographics of Lake View?
Lake View has a population of approximately 170. The median household income is $66,279. The median home value is $94,631. Research shows that economic factors can correlate with crime rates, though many other variables play a role in neighborhood safety.
